Best of luck, seriously, but there are 4 problems:
1. The lockout - if it lasts all year, they cannot get Howard!
2. Howard has said he wants to play out his option in ORL.
3. Otis (my man) Smith says you need to take Arenas or Turkoglu if you take Howard. At least that is what he is saying now.
4. This is NOT the Melo situation. The Magic have all the control here. They can trade him to anyone they want at any time. The Knicks had salary cap space. So when Melo said he wanted to play for the Knicks, he held all the cards. If the Nuggets didn't trade him, he ended up where he wanted to go anyway. In this case, if they don't trade him to the lakers, he can't go to them. He will end up in MN or CLE for half a year, then be a free agent...and STILL not be able to go the lakers.
And, as we have said, you need a point guard anyway.........sorry man, I just don't see it!!
